Black Silicon Carbide P type for Coated Abrasives: Grit Sizes & Applications

Black silicon carbide is a high-performance abrasive for coated products, valued for its Mohs hardness of 9.15, sharp hexagonal crystals, and excellent adhesion to backings like paper or cloth . Tailored for coated abrasives, it offers a comprehensive grit size range adhering to FEPA, ANSI, and JIS standards, with approximately 40+ regular grades and customizable specifications .

The grit system is categorized by application needs:

Coarse grades (P12–P80/F4–F80): Particles range from 180–2000μm . Ideal for aggressive surface preparation-removing rust, scale, or weld spatter from metals, and shaping cast iron/non-ferrous alloys . 40–60 mesh variants are widely used in skateboard anti-slip sandpaper for strong grip, though they wear soles faster .

Medium grades (P100–P220/F100–F220): 53–180μm particles balance cutting speed and finish. They serve as primary grits for sanding belts/discs, smoothing wood/plastics, and prepping surfaces for painting/electroplating . P120–P150 grades are preferred for automotive body filler sanding .

Fine/Micro grades (P240–P2500/F240–F1200, JIS 240#–6000#): 2–106μm particles enable precision polishing. P320–P600 are used for optical components and semiconductor wafers, while P1000–P2500 deliver mirror finishes in jewelry making . JIS 4000#–6000# micro-grits suit lapping of advanced ceramics .

Notably, P-grit series (sharp, self-sharpening) is purpose-built for coated abrasives, ensuring strong resin adhesion , while F-grit variants are occasionally adopted for heavy-duty coated tools . All grades maintain ≥98.5% SiC purity (up to 99.0% for coarse grits) for consistent performance .
